Review Of Car Garage Farnborough Ideas. Web located at 24a invincible road industrial estate, farnborough, we are ideally based to serve the local farnborough,. With the experience i have had running 2 large. The 'Secret' Farnborough car park that can't be accessed by cars ITV News from www.itv.com Visit our showroom or give one of • Read More »